Sometimes teachers need help finding a resource for a unit of study in their class - it may be journal prompts, project ideas, or an example unit lesson to learn from. Instead of spending money at Teachers Pay Teachers...check out Curriki. This library of resources created by teachers for teachers has lots of searchable and curated resources for teachers. Be sure to evaluate each resource to ensure it meets your TEKS, Learning Target, etc.

You can search by subject or grade level: Or you can enter your own search terms...I entered Romeo and Juliet and it came up with over 70,000 resources:   And then there are the curated collections:     Let us know if you use any of the resources from this site! We'd love to hear how you use them!
